Englewood, NJ
Bergen County
Englewood adopted the New Jersey model EV ordinance, requiring a portion of new development parking to include charging stations or make-ready spaces.

Bergen County
Teaneck follows New Jersey's statewide model EV ordinance requiring charging-ready spaces at new developments and prohibiting non-EVs from blocking designated charging stalls.

Englewood FAQ
Does Englewood require EV charging at new apartment buildings?
Yes. New multifamily, commercial, and mixed-use projects must include a portion of installed EV charging stations and additional make-ready parking spaces under Section 250-85 of the Englewood code.
Do I need a permit to install a home EV charger in Englewood?
Yes. Residential Level 2 chargers require an electrical permit from the Englewood Building Department. New Jersey treats EVSE as a permitted accessory use, so zoning approval is generally automatic.
Teaneck FAQ
Can I install a Level 2 charger at my Teaneck home?
Yes. Homeowners need an electrical permit and inspection. Most installations are permitted as accessory uses without separate zoning approval.
Can a non-EV park in a charging space?
No. Designated EV charging spaces are reserved for vehicles connected to the charger. Non-EVs blocking these spaces may be ticketed under local enforcement.
